The Feds are looking at increasing the ethanol in gasoline to 15% up from the current 10%. E-10 is already creating issues so there are a number of boating organizations trying to head that off since they claim no boat engine has been designed certified or warrantied to run on anything higher than E-10 CLICK HERE for a link to NMMA's campaign complete with sample email to send to the EPA before their public comment period closes July 20, 2009. |
